A/C Pro is a hardware-companion utility by Energizer designed to guide DIYers through vehicle A/C recharging. It leverages Bluetooth integration and a vehicle-specific database to differentiate itself from generic tutorials. However, the app is currently in a state of technical failure, characterized by an 'Upset' user base and declining category rankings (#87, ↓12).

Key features
Connects the app to A/C Pro gauges via Bluetooth for real-time, adaptive, and guided recharge instructions.
Provides step-by-step guidance tailored to the user's specific vehicle year, make, and model.
A visual database of images helping users locate the low side pressure port on their specific vehicle.
How much does it cost?
The app serves as a value-added utility to drive sales of physical A/C Pro hardware products rather than as a standalone revenue generator.

Development momentum is stagnant, with only two minor updates released since August 2023. There is no evidence of new feature development or significant platform expansion. The app appears to be in a zombie state, receiving only infrequent stability tweaks and bug fixes.

Bottom line
If I were the PM, I would immediately halt feature expansion to fix the broken onboarding and server infrastructure, as the app is currently a brand liability. While the Bluetooth 'Smartcharge' is a strong differentiator, it is useless if the app cannot validate a UPC or load a video without a 502 error.
